Support upgrades trails equipment




The Kachemak Nordic Ski Club would like to thank the David and Mary Schroer advised fund at the Homer Foundation for the generous support provided for a project to upgrade the equipment used to groom Nordic ski trails in the Homer area. The money provided by this grant is being used to help fund the purchase of two additional grooming machines.

The ski trail system recently has undergone significant expansion with new trails at Lookout Mountain, a connector trail between Lookout Mountain and Baycrest and trail work at the McNeil/Eveline and Baycrest areas. These upgrades have led to the need for additional grooming equipment to help maintain the trails that provide the excellent skiing residents of Homer, as well as winter visitors, have come to expect.

The expanded trail system provides cross country skiing opportunities for all, from beginning skiers to experienced racers. We invite everyone to come out and experience the excellent groomed trails that our volunteers are able to provide with the help of the equipment obtained through projects such as this.

Richard Burton, secretary

Kachemak Nordic Ski Club
